Engineering & Physical Sciences in Medicine ConferenceThe Engineering & Physical Sciences in Medicine Conference `95 and 3rd Asia- Pacific Regional Conference of the IEEE Engineering in Medicine and Biology Society will take place at Queenstown, New Zealand, 20-24 November 1995. The Conference will be sponsored by the Australasian College of Physical Scientists and Engineers in Medicine, College of Biomedical Engineers, Institution of Engineers (Australia) and the IEEE Engineering in Medicine & Biology Society. This Conference will celebrate the centenary of Rontgen's discovery of X-rays and the 50th anniversary of the first hospital physicist appointment in New Zealand. Dr. Warren Sinclair was appointed to Dunedin Hospital in November 1945. Now an internationally renowned biophysicist and President Emeritus of the National Council on Radiation Protection and Measurements, Dr. Sinclair has been invited to launch the Conference as the John Strong Memorial lecturer.
